Output 5e1ae98d6fcd03e7b52096024d83792ac7e2e58a3a6acacb28e9ded1f2487219:0

value
235532536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d33ef331f37ed24e88c0597347f83f94e8db9a0 OP_EQUAL
address
38jEAn6HNe2QBTLcUegenCFcstNrWERpSg
transaction
5e1ae98d6fcd03e7b52096024d83792ac7e2e58a3a6acacb28e9ded1f2487219
confirmations
173066
spent
true